Nnngenerate pdf reports in jsp iis

First create a web application in netbeans, add the appropriate version of jar files of jasper report you created withsee the. I cannot seem to generate the pdf report from this jsp page. We create a sample application to better understand itext. This tag is used to generate the html code and to embed the applet into it. Using itext to generate pdf reports in a jsp cloud computing. It is a business intelligence reporting tools that used to design and generate reports from a range of data. Using jsp, you can collect input from users through webpage forms, present. Jsp technology is used to create dynamic web applications. It then summarizes how to obtain and configure the software you need to write servlets and develop jsp documents. You can use the pdfwriter class that comes with this package, which includes a quick tutorial from ibm on how to use it. Open pdf with jspservlet in internet explorer solutions. The origin of the problem not long ago done a jsp to generate a pdf report of the small project, it is an open vision.

Normally iis can not execute servlets and java server pages jsps, configuring iis to use the. Jsp configuration 3 standard jsp actions 6 white space preservation 145 attributes 147 comments 147 quoting and escape characters 149 implicit objects 150 pagecontext 153 out 154 config 157 page 159 jsp in xml syntax 159 xml rules 162 jsp documents 162 summary 165 viii contents. Write html read and maintain the html jsp makes it possible to. Jul 27, 2006 by no stretch of imagination is getting jsp running invisibly with iis 6 an easy job, and heres the best way to do it. Web developers write jsps as text files that combine html or xhtml code, xml elements, and embedded jsp actions and commands. This file is similar to a jsp file, but uses xml syntax and may be modified using web development application or a basic text editor. How to integrate iis with jboss tomcat under windows.

In the above code, we are using document parameterized constructor, with the following parameters. But if you are returning binary data like a pdf, msword doc, or other noncharacter entity then you need to drop down to using the response outputstream directly. Officeenabled export only works for report services documents opened in a standalone. This tag helps in forwarding the current request to servlet or to jsp page. Mar 24, 2009 generating password and id and triggering mail. Using this the jsp object can be used within the page whee it was created. Jk isapi redirector plug in will let iis send servlet and jsp. Jsp enables us to write html pages containing tags, inside which we can include powerful java programs. Isapi redirector for micrsoft iis howto apache tomcat. Here is an example for a servlet generating pdf output and you might also want to take a look at this faq entry. Net class library is used to generate precise pdf documents.

Generating pdf from jsp using itext jsp forum at coderanch. Some of the products that appear on this site are from companies from which quinstreet receives compensation. Jsp pages are opposite of servlets as a servlet adds html code inside java code, while jsp adds java code inside html using jsp tags. The conclusion for each parameter is also mentioned in our report. If this is still not working, you might want to switch into a servlet the jsp compiler might produce some nasty out. Currently from the submit jsp j1where user selects the select report, it goes to the handlerh1, where it gets the report from sas. Adding php and asp support is a cinch, and in no time at all, iis 6 can serve anything you throw at it except jsp files of course. In this guide, well be using iis 6 on windows server 2003 with sp1 installed, together with the tomcat servlet engine version 5.

Jsp form is a way to interact with user input with web server or database server. Javaserver pages jsp 2 jsp agenda introducing javaserver pagestm jsptm jsp scripting elements the jsp page directive. Htmlstyle comments pass through the jsp page engine unmodified. Jsp page is a simple text file consisting of html or xml content along with jsp elements sort of shorthand for java code inside the jsp container is a special servletcalled the page compiler. The browser uses two methods to pass this information to web server. Normally iis can not execute servlets and java server pages jsps. But you should a stream object like servletoutputstream to. Iis to use the isapi redirector plugin will let iis send servlet and jsp. This article introduces itext and gives a stepbystep guide to using it to generate pdf documents from java technology applications. Calling jasper report from java web application using jsp.

Jsp i about the tutorial java server pages jsp is a serverside programming technology that enables the creation of dynamic, platformindependent method for building webbased applications. Hello all i am trying to generate pdf from jsp and i am using itext library. To register a jsp using xml, write an xml file to update the jsplookup propertybundle, adding a mapping between a specific classname and mime type insuranceform. This section discusses how to deploy a jsp report with a paper layout. Structuring generated servletstm including files in jsp documents using javabeans components with jsp creating custom jsp tag libraries integrating servlets and jsp. If you want to deploy a jsp report with a paper and web layout, follow the steps in section 18. The availability of an jsp object to be used is usually defined by the scope of that object. In this example i will show you how to call jasper report. So if the report type is pdf or excel, we forward to temporary jsp, which has the scripts added and run and onload of this page the reload is called for.

Like 6 0 crystal reports is a dynamic reporting tool. So if the report type is pdf or excel, we forward to temporary jsp, which has the scripts added and run and onload of this page the reload is called for the same handlerh1to avoid the back url issue. Crystal reports establish a connection with java and j2ee framework to display variety of report. They appear in the html source passed to the requesting client. Currently from the submit jspj1where user selects the select report, it goes to the handlerh1, where it gets the report from sas. Weve pulled most of the java code into custom jsp tags. This page is the root page for the part of the site used to view basic reports. Many people love the ease and security of using internet information services 6 server on windows 2003. Calling jasper report from java web application using jsp posted on june 2, 20 by admin comments as i mentioned earlier in my previous post that if you are creating a jrxmljasper file using a particular version of ireport you must use same set of jars for your application. Nov 24, 20 but if you are returning binary data like a pdf, msword doc, or other noncharacter entity then you need to drop down to using the response outputstream directly.

A javaserver pages component is a type of java servlet that is designed to fulfill the role of a user interface for a java web application. If you plan to use iis as the web server for microstrategy web, you must. An introduction to xml and web technologies jsp programming. The research experience at osaka university, considered in its entirety, has been extremely stimulating. Generate pdf files from java applications dynamically. Each page takes upon the complete task of fulfilling a request. In this paper we present a survey on web servers iis, apache, sun java web.

Create a method for creating the pdf file and write logic. Model i architecture in model 1 architecture, a series of jsp pages or servlets do all the work. Servlets, jsp, struts and mvc part i agile developer. Dinktopdf is a crossplatform oriented library which is the wrapper for the webkit html to pdf library. Generate pdf report from jsp jsp forum at coderanch. This compensation may impact how and where products appear on this site including, for example, the order in which they appear. Using javabeans with jsp topics in this chapter creating and accessing beans installing bean classes on your server setting bean properties explicitly associating bean properties with input parameters automatic conversion of bean property types. Jspstyle comments do not increase the size of the document that results from the jsp page, but are useful to enhance the readability of the jsp page source, and to simplify debugging the servlet generated from the. The current version of the pdf exporting feature doesnt support the. Everything a servlet can do, a jsp page can also do it. Jsp reports can be deployed either to the web or to paper, depending on the layout the report designer used for the jsp report. By no stretch of imagination is getting jsp running invisibly with iis 6 an easy job, and heres the best way to do it.

If your application needs to generate pdf documents dynamically, you need the itext library. Pdf studio maintains full compatibility with the pdf standard. Some of the pages require registration and some are hidden from view and are only accessible if you have signed a licence agreement note that detailed industry reports are also available from enappsys which are written by our market analysts on a monthly and weekly basis. Three months went by incredibly quickly, and this seemed to me even more incredible given that settling in practically required no time at all contrary to what i expected. It will allow us to create a pdf document from our html string that we generate in the. Net core project, or to create a pdf document from an existing html page. How to call another jsp from a jsp unable to run jsp on tomcat server in fedora jsp code to connect to oracle db in fedora trying to access txt file from jsp page org. Using javabeans with jsp topics in this chapter creating and accessing beans installing bean classes on your server setting bean properties explicitly associating bean properties with input parameters automatic conversion of bean property types sharing beans among multiple jsp pages and servlets. Some of the pages require registration and some are hidden from view and are only accessible if you have signed a licence agreement. As i mentioned earlier in my previous post that if you are creating a jrxmljasper file using a particular version of ireport you must use same set of jars for your application. Jsp have access to the entire family of java apis, including the jdbc api to access enterprise databases.

The following table lists folders and files of interest that are included in. Hi we are generating pdf report from the servlet if the client enters data through their forms. Produced from a server using jsp functions xhtml web page file that is used to provide dynamic content on the web. Net that can be used to create dynamic pdfresponse pages. We have to follow some simple steps for generating the pdf file. This article will discuss about how you may integrate your crystal reports with jsp pages and also show how to generate a crystal report. Net that can be used to create dynamic pdf response pages. Supports jasperreports, jfreereport, jxls, and eclipse birt. Jspx files may be run with any web browser that is compatible with java server pages with the java virtual machine. It is a business intelligence reporting tools that used to design and generate reports from a range of data sources like oracle and mysql.

200 257 1050 205 118 1637 1497 17 1126 449 1282 631 910 685 1170 993 37 1113 986 542 274 1597 1390 94 1036 868 1013 1192 1 544 987 554 1107 103 331